Company description
The Piazza shopping centre is located in central Hornsby, off George Street near Hornsby train station. The many shops are locally owned & include Dentistry, Skin clinic, Chinese Hebal Medicine, Hairdressers & shoe repair,Wool and craft,Cafe & restaurant,Fish and Chips takeaway